    Understanding the Basics: Diamond Pickaxe Breakdown

    Let's start with the OG: the diamond pickaxe. For years, the diamond pickaxe has been the gold standard, the go-to tool for miners everywhere. But why? Well, its advantages are numerous and well-documented. Firstly, diamonds are relatively easy to find, especially once you've established yourself in a world. You can find them in cave systems, abandoned mineshafts, or through trading with villagers. Once you have your diamonds, crafting a diamond pickaxe is straightforward. All you need are two sticks and three diamonds, a resource readily available in your gameplay journey. The diamond pickaxe offers decent speed when mining, making it quicker to gather resources. It also boasts durability, meaning it can withstand a fair amount of use before breaking. This longevity is crucial, especially when you're deep underground and far from your crafting table. When you're in the dark, you don't want to worry about the pickaxe breaking in the middle of a vital mining run. But maybe most importantly, the diamond pickaxe can mine every single block in the game and is quite easy to get.     Introducing the Iopal Pickaxe: A New Contender

    Now, let's turn our attention to the iopal pickaxe, a lesser-known but increasingly popular tool in the Minecraft community. The iopal pickaxe isn't a vanilla item; it typically comes from mods or custom resource packs. Because of this, the exact stats and abilities of an iopal pickaxe can vary widely. Some mods may give the iopal pickaxe unique properties, such as enhanced mining speed, increased durability, or special abilities like auto-smelting or area mining. The availability of iopal pickaxes is something to think about too, as they rely on installing and managing mods or resource packs. This can add a layer of complexity for some players who prefer a pure vanilla experience. Modding can sometimes introduce compatibility issues or even affect the game's performance. The main advantage of the iopal pickaxe comes from the fact that it is generally superior to the diamond pickaxe in terms of speed, durability, and special abilities. This means faster mining, longer tool life, and potentially the ability to mine multiple blocks at once or automatically smelt ores as they are mined.

    Tips for Maximizing Your Mining Efficiency

    Regardless of which pickaxe you choose, here are some tips to maximize your mining efficiency:

    • Enchant Your Pickaxe: Apply enchantments like Efficiency and Unbreaking to your pickaxe to boost its mining speed and durability. These enchantments can significantly improve your mining experience, making it faster and more efficient. For the diamond pickaxe, you can enhance its capabilities using the enchanting table, which will provide it with advanced mining power. For the iopal pickaxe, you can add enchantments depending on the specific mod you're using. Check what enchantments are compatible with the pickaxe you have.
    • Use Potions: Potions like Haste can temporarily increase your mining speed. Use potions to speed up your mining process, especially when dealing with tough blocks or when you need to gather resources quickly.
    • Mine Strategically: Don't just blindly mine; plan your routes to cover as much ground as possible. For instance, you could use the branch mining technique, where you create parallel tunnels. This systematic approach helps you to find more resources and prevents you from missing valuable ores.
    • Combine with Other Tools: Use other tools, such as shovels and axes, for specific tasks. For instance, you can use a shovel to clear dirt and gravel quickly. And a well-enchanted axe will give you an advantage when cutting trees, ensuring you collect wood and resources quickly.
    • Prioritize Efficiency: Focus on the resources you need the most. For example, if you need iron, prioritize mining for it first. Efficient resource gathering ensures that you are gathering the materials you require in less time, allowing you to concentrate on other aspects of the game.
